Jerry Jordan of First Interstate tapped to lead Cleveland Fed. (First Interstate Bancorp.,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land) (Brief Article)

Prominent bank economist Jerry L. Jordan has been named president of the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land, the bank announced Tuesday.

He will assume the post March 10.

Mr. Jordan, chief economist of First Interstate Bancorp in Los Angeles since 1985, holds a doctrine in economics from the University of California in that city.

He began his career in 1967 as an economist at the St. Louis Fed and rose to the post of senior vice president and director of research before departing in 1975.
